Usage Recommendations

Install smoke alarms on ceilings or high on walls away from windows and doors to reduce the chance of drafts interrupting detection. Place the heat alarm where steam or cooking fumes are likely but keep it clear of direct cooking sources to avoid frequent false alerts. Use the remote control for regular testing and to silence unwanted alarms temporarily, which can be helpful during cooking or cleaning. 🔧
Regular weekly testing is advised according to standard safety guidance, and note that sealed batteries mean the units are maintenance-light but will still display end-of-life signals when replacement of the whole unit is required. Also be aware that wireless range can be affected by thick walls or metal structures, so test interlinking after installation to confirm coverage.
